Transaction 7415777edbdbc91d6f9d93ac649ffb4d9e3424607552147423fa96268b09451b

1 Input
2 Outputs
  • 7415777edbdbc91d6f9d93ac649ffb4d9e3424607552147423fa96268b09451b:0
  • value  134030
    address  19dTpuJdAuHUdUXgnPYb9TPhG3BEMaxUBA
  • 7415777edbdbc91d6f9d93ac649ffb4d9e3424607552147423fa96268b09451b:1
  • value  9476825
    address  1BSS6EZyLHUSG7cL9yYw1KdUkRCLahursP